3 Wheeled Buggies
A 3-wheel buggy is perfect for off-roading and taking on terrains from bumpy pavements to woodland tracks. They can also be easier to manoeuvre up and down kerbs than 4-wheel models.

Stability
With four wheels and a centre of gravity that's balanced by weight of your child's seat, 4-wheel buggies are generally considered to be more stable than 3-wheelers. But that doesn't mean that the three-wheel buggie isn't worth considering, since the majority of these models are designed to handle everything from rough terrain to bustling high-streets.
If you want a buggie that is easy to handle and won't be a problem on bumpy pavements, look for one with large rear wheels and an adjustable front wheel that locks. These all-terrain buggies often have pneumatic tyres, too. They are great at handling non-paved surfaces and can be used on sandy beaches or woodland tracks.
They're also great buggies to jog with because they provide great stability in rough terrain and help you stay with your running companion. They can also go up and down steep kerbs and a lot of them come with a spring suspension built-in so that your baby can enjoy an enjoyable ride.
The one thing that can make a 3 wheeled pushchairs-wheeled pushchair tricky to maneuver is the large frame, which makes it difficult to squeeze through narrow and tight doorways than a 4-wheeler. However some manufacturers have solved this issue by implementing a clever design that makes the wheels fold up when they are not in use, which decreases their overall size and allows you navigate through doorways without difficulty.

Manoeuvrability
Three-wheeled buggies generally provide better maneuverability than four-wheeled pushchairs. They usually have a swivelling front wheel that lets you change direction quickly and steer with only one hand. Some also come with a lockable front wheels which gives you security on more difficult terrain. Certain models can be used with an additional seat or buggy board, in case you want to expand your family.
If you're considering taking your three-wheeled buggy off tracks that are paved, it's worth selecting a model with air-filled tyres (also called pneumatic tyres) which can cope with the toughest terrain. These tyres may need to be filled from time to intervals, but they'll be more durable and puncture-proof compared to solid tyres. You should look for models with an swiveling front wheel that can be locked to assist you on tricky surfaces.
When folded, three wheeled buggies-wheelers may be more bulky than four-wheeled buggies due to the single front wheel. Make sure the model you choose fits in the boot of your vehicle and can be sat up should it be needed. Certain models can fold in one hand and are freestanding when collapsed, which will save space in smaller car boots.

Fabric Sling Seat
The primary distinction between a fabric seat and a modular one is the fabric sling. It is placed inside the buggy frame, rather than being positioned on top of it like the modular chair. This allows for a more ergonomically correct position for baby, which instantly delivers an lower centre of gravity that is at the proper height. This leads to a more comfortable push, a more light curb-pop (you don't need to exert the same effort and weight to lift the buggy off the curb) and improved balance and stability.
These double buggy 3 wheels seats also feature Sling fabrics that are simple to clean and durable. These fabrics were designed specifically for the sling chair and are UV resistant and air-tight. These fabrics are also very easy to maintain with mild soap and warm water.
If you're a jogger, or like to do some off-roading, a all terrain 3 wheeler will be more your bag than a 4-wheeler. These types generally have a larger base, more stable and utilise air filled tyres for agile smooth movement on rough ground.
